Chris McQueen's Guitars
The image for the interview shows Chris' Moollon Les Paul style guitar. At 53:15 Chris describes the guitar.
Chris can be seen playing a Moollon Custom T Thinline in this video.
Chris can be seen playing a D'Angelico EX-SD with Snarky Puppy in this video from 2014.

Snarky Puppy LIVE @ LEAF Spring 2018. Chris can be seen playing his Heritage H-150 the entire show.
Supro Coronado W/ Danelectro Baritone demo by Chris McQueen.
Chris uses the Heritage H-535 in this demo of the Supro Saturn Reverb.
From 4:25 Chris can be seen with his Thinline Tele.
Chris McQueen can be seen playing a Tokai Silver Star in several photos from the "Snarky live" feature on Stella-k, where the model is clearly identified on the guitar's headstock.
On the fourth photo with Chris' gear, a fender mustang can be seen off to the left.
Chris can be seen playing a Fender Stratocaster in this photo.
Throughout the 'Western Theatre' Album, Chris can be seen playing his Collings OM2H.
Michael League: "Love this guitar! Chris McQueen plays it on Family Dinner VOl2." Chris is playing it in the cover photo.
Chris is playing a Moollon T Classic in the band FORQ.
Chris plays a Les Paul Studio before taking out the hammertone.
Chris' Rickenbacker can be seen in this photo of his Forq recording setup.
The Harmony Stratotone can be seen in this photo of Chris' Forq recording setup.
The Harmony Silvertone can be seen in this photo of Chris' Forq recording setup.
Chris uses a double humbucker ES-175 in this video.
In this video, Chris can be seen playing a Waterloo WL-14.
In the first photo, Chris is shown using a sticker covered Fender Telecaster. The guitar is owned by Foe Destroyer bandmate Daniel Garcia.
In this photo, Chris can be seen playing a Les Paul Standard.
Chris can be seen a Metallic Blue Eastwood Sidejack Baritone in this video.
